What a fantastic gift to see this sweet face outside our window this morning. I love this time of year when the air turns cooler and the blacktail deer spend more time close by.

We often have a small herd of 2-5 of these lovely beings grazing and resting in our neighborhood. We’ve seen as many as 7 in one spot feeding on the berries and other flora. They’re acclimated to people, yet fully maintain their wild instincts. There’s no getting close or petting happening. We keep the physical admiration at a reasonable distance.
